[quote][b]Robo[/b] wrote: I just spent the last 3 days trying to work out why my distance checks fail to be consistent and change according to what angle you approach the child node item. The problem was the parent folder being a child itself under a 3D mesh which had a scale adjustment applied outside 1,1,1. Never do that !! - will stuff up the game and make you think the engine is broken. Unchild the parent folder from the 3D mesh and put in the main section by itself. The javascript for distance checks are these: var posdelta = this.LastPosition.substract(currentPos); var dist = Math.sqrt(posdelta.x * posdelta.x + posdelta.z * posdelta.z); or var posdelta = this.LastPosition.substract(currentPos); var dist = posdelta.getLength(); (they both do exactly the same thing). Hope this help someone one-day....driving me crazy these weird bugs...[/quote]
